How to reproduce: Disable everything like User-specified font color, fonts,
etc. Disable smileys everywhere. And have a contact on MSN who uses smileys.

Somehow, the partner said the she doesnt uses characters for the missing words,
only for "o" for example, but that one works. I couldn't think anything else
besides the smileys. But it seems thats not the issue.

It looks like this:
Example1: Kola, koszi
That becomes:: ola, oszi

Example2: betuvel
That becomes: betuel
(the u - e becomes one (really close to each other) but there is nothing
between them)

If I try to copy the line and paste it to kopete, I Cant see anything.

It looks like this if I paste the lines into Firefox:
"hát tényleg nemtom,de csa a  betűel van ily"
"mindeninél j"

ps.: I tried KDEbug application turn to max, run kopete from terminal, but no
help. No errors.

Tried this method as well:
Open a terminal and play with the next line:
export LC_ALL=hu_HU.UTF-8
then start kopete from there:
kopete

Tried these ones: hu_HU.ISO-8859-2, en_US, en_US-UTF-8, POSIX

Any idea?
